Soviet Realism: Echoes of Utopia and Dissent
Soviet Realism, an artistic movement burgeoning following the Soviet Revolution, attempted to capture the spirit of socialist life. Encouraged by Soviet authorities, it aimed to depict the heroic proletariat triumphantly overcoming the hardships of building a a socialist future. Yet, beneath this veneer of state-sanctioned art, resistance often seeped through. Artists, operating within limitations, employed visual metaphors to express their anxieties about the realities of Soviet life. The result became a nuanced body of work that simultaneously celebrates Soviet ideals while revealing a deeper truth about the human condition under totalitarian rule.

The Literary accolade Honoring Russian Genius
Throughout history, the Nobel Prize in Literature has lauded the brilliance of countless writers from across the globe. However, few nations have contributed as many literary titans as Russia. From the poignant prose of Dostoevsky to the lyrical poetry of Pushkin, Russian authors have consistently captured the human experience with depth and powerful narratives.
The Nobel Prize has functioned as a testament to this enduring legacy, bestowing its prestigious honor upon numerous Russian visionaries. This recognition not only emphasizes the exceptional talent within Russia but also exposes the profound impact of Russian literature on world culture.
Each laureate, in spite of their diverse approaches, has shared a commitment to literary excellence and a drive for exploring the complexities of the human soul. Their works have overcome cultural limits, resonating with readers worldwide and leaving an indelible mark on the landscape of world literature.
